Plasma Engine  2.0
Loading...
Searching...
No Matches
plAiPerceptionGenPOI Class Reference
Inheritance diagram for plAiPerceptionGenPOI:

Public Member Functions

virtual plStringView GetPerceptionType () override
 
virtual void UpdatePerceptions (plGameObject &owner, const plAiSensorManager &ref_SensorManager) override
 
virtual bool HasPerceptions () const override
 
virtual void GetPerceptions (plDynamicArray< const plAiPerception * > &out_Perceptions) const override
 
virtual void FlagNeededSensors (plAiSensorManager &ref_SensorManager) override
 

Member Function Documentation

◆ FlagNeededSensors()

void plAiPerceptionGenPOI::FlagNeededSensors ( plAiSensorManager & ref_SensorManager)
overridevirtual

◆ GetPerceptions()

void plAiPerceptionGenPOI::GetPerceptions ( plDynamicArray< const plAiPerception * > & out_Perceptions) const
overridevirtual

◆ GetPerceptionType()

virtual plStringView plAiPerceptionGenPOI::GetPerceptionType ( )
inlineoverridevirtual

◆ HasPerceptions()

bool plAiPerceptionGenPOI::HasPerceptions ( ) const
overridevirtual

◆ UpdatePerceptions()

void plAiPerceptionGenPOI::UpdatePerceptions ( plGameObject & owner,
const plAiSensorManager & ref_SensorManager )
overridevirtual

The documentation for this class was generated from the following files: